Lemon Arugula Pasta Salad

A refreshing and zesty pasta salad featuring arugula, lemon, and a light dressing, perfect for a summer meal.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Salad, side
Cuisine: Italian
Calories: 320

Ingredients
  

Pasta
  • 8 oz fusilli pasta or any pasta of choice
Vegetables
  • 4 cups arugula fresh
Dressing
  • 1/4 cup extra virgin olive oil
  • 2 tbsp fresh lemon juice about 1 lemon
  • 1 tsp lemon zest freshly grated
  • 1 tsp honey optional for sweetness
  • 1/2 tsp salt to taste
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per to taste
Toppings
  • 1/2 cup cherry tomatoes halved
  • 1/4 cup parmesan cheese shredded or grated
  • 1/4 cup pine nuts toasted

Method
 

Cook Pasta
  1.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Add the fusilli pasta and cook according to package instructions until al dente, about 8-10 minutes.
  2. Drain the pasta in a colander and rinse under cold water to cool.
Prepare Dressing
  1. In a mixing bowl, whisk together the olive oil, lemon juice, lemon zest, honey, salt, and black pepper until well combined.
Combine Ingredients
  1. In a large serving bowl, combine the cooled pasta, arugula, cherry tomatoes, and dressing. Toss gently to combine.
  2. Top with parmesan cheese and toasted pine nuts before serving.

Nutrition

Serving: 1servingCalories: 320kcalCarbohydrates: 35gProtein: 10gFat: 18gSaturated Fat: 3gFiber: 3gSugar: 2g

Notes

This salad can be served immediately or chilled in the refrigerator for 30 minutes for a refreshing taste.
